  • Understanding the glass transition temperature of HPMC is crucial in its application. For example, in pharmaceutical formulations, the glass transition temperature of HPMC can influence the release profile of the drug from the dosage form. If the glass transition temperature is too close to the storage temperature of the formulation, it may lead to unwanted changes in the physical properties of the dosage form, affecting its efficacy.
  • RDP powder, also known as Redispersible Polymer Powder, is a free-flowing white powder that is easily soluble in water. It is usually made from a mixture of vinyl acetate and ethylene, which gives it excellent adhesive and bonding properties. RDP powder is commonly used as a key ingredient in the production of construction materials, such as tile adhesives, grouts, and self-leveling compounds.

  • One of the most significant applications of HPMC is in the pharmaceutical industry. It is commonly employed as a controlled-release agent in drug formulations, ensuring that medications are released in a sustained manner. HPMC is also used as a binder in tablets and as a thickener in various liquid formulations, providing the necessary viscosity to ensure stability and efficacy.

Polymer-based additives are often used to improve the flexibility and adhesion of cement-based materials, making them ideal for applications such as waterproofing or crack repair. Silica fume, on the other hand, is a pozzolanic material that can enhance the strength and durability of concrete by filling in the gaps between cement particles. Fly ash is another popular additive that can improve the workability and long-term performance of concrete by reducing the amount of water needed for hydration.

  • Moreover, in the pharmaceutical industry, Cellosize® HEC serves vital functions as a binder, coating agent, and thickener in various drug formulations. Its biocompatibility and non-toxic nature make it suitable for use in oral medications, ensuring that the active ingredients are delivered effectively. The versatility of Cellosize® HEC allows for the development of controlled-release formulations, which is crucial for optimizing therapeutic effects and minimizing side effects.

  • In the construction industry, HPMC is used as a thickener and water retention agent in cement-based mortars, plasters, and tile adhesives. It improves the workability of the mixture, allowing for easier application and better adhesion to surfaces. HPMC also acts as a dispersant, reducing the amount of water needed in the formulation, which in turn improves the strength and durability of the final product.

  • In the food industry, HPMC is commonly used as a thickener and stabilizer in various products, including sauces, dressings, and frozen desserts. It helps to improve the texture and mouthfeel of the products, as well as preventing ingredients from separating. HPMC is also used as a vegetarian alternative to gelatin in products such as gummy candies and marshmallows.

  • HPMC 4000 cps is known for its high viscosity, making it an ideal choice for applications that require a thickening agent or a film-forming agent. In the pharmaceutical industry, HPMC 4000 cps is often used as a binder in tablet formulations, as it helps to hold the active ingredients together and improve the overall stability of the tablet. It is also commonly used as a sustained-release agent, allowing for controlled release of the medication over a period of time.
